zhb at a glance
The Center for Higher Education is a central scientific unit consisting of the five divisions Disability and Studies (DoBuS), Foreign Languages, Academic Teaching & Faculty Development, Statistical Consulting and Analysis (SBAZ) and Continuing Education. These divisions offer you a variety of seminars, coaching programs as well as education programs. These are closely linked to four professorships where comprehensive research is conducted on the services offered, ensuring that you will receive the latest research findings at first hand.
